Dear valued customers:
In order to improve performance of 15mL centrifuge tube, we increased the wall thickness of it. So, now, with more material, New Generation would be harder and could be able to withstand higher centrifuge force.
Though the capacity of the tube still could reach the 15mL, the total volume of the tube is a little smaller than before, so it makes the position of graduation 15mL too near to the screw and ineffective to print. Therefore, the maximum graduation of the new tube would be 14mL now. We are very sorry if this changing makes your customers too confused and inconvenience if this may cause.
